Deceleration trajectory is key for airbag activa-
tion.
The control unit analyses the collision trajec-
tory and activates the respective restraint sys-
tem.
If the deceleration rate is below the predened
reference value in the control unit the airbags
will not be triggered, even though the accident
may cause extensive damage to the car.
The following airbags are triggered in serious
head-on collisions:
●
Driver airbag.
●
Front passenger front airbag
●
Head airbags.
In the event of serious side collisions, some
(or all) of the following airbags can be acti-
vated (depending on the severity of the col-
lision):
●
Head airbags.
●
Front side airbag on the side of the accident.
●
Central airbag.
In an accident with airbag activation:
●
the interior lights switch on (if the interior
light switch is in the courtesy light position);
●
the hazard warning lights switch on;
●
all doors are unlocked;
●
the high voltage system is switched o;
●
an emergency call is started.
Airbag system control lamps
Lights up on the instrument cluster
Fault in the airbag system and seat belt
tensioners. Have the system checked im-
mediately by a specialised workshop.
Lights up on the instrument cluster
Airbag or belt tensioner system deacti-
vated by a diagnostic tester. Contact a
specialised workshop and get it to check
whether the airbag or belt tensioner sys-
tem should remain deactivated.
Lights up on the roof console
Front passenger airbag deactivated.
Check if the airbag should be kept deacti-
vated.
Lights up on the roof console
Front passenger airbag activated. The
control lamp turns o automatically 60
seconds after the ignition is switched on.
Several warning and control lamps light up for a
few seconds when the ignition is switched on,
signalling that the function is being veried.
They will switch o after a few seconds.
If the airbag and seat belt tensioner system
control lamp remains on or ashes, it indi-
cates a malfunction in the airbag and seat belt
tensioner system ››› . Have the system
checked immediately by a specialised work-
shop.
If the front passenger airbag has been deacti-
vated, the warning lamp
remains lit on
the roof console to remind you that the airbag
is deactivated. If, with the front passenger air-
bag deactivated, this lamp does not remain
lit or if it is lit along with the control lamp
on the instrument cluster, there is a fault in
the airbag system ››› . If the control lamp is
ashing, there is a fault in the disabling of the
airbag system ››› . Have the system checked
immediately by a specialised workshop.
WARNING
In the event of a fault in the airbag and seat
belt tensioner system, the airbags and seat
belts may not trigger correctly, may fail to
trigger or may even trigger unexpectedly.
●
The vehicle occupants run the risk of sus-
taining severe or fatal injuries. Have the sys-
tem checked immediately by a specialised
workshop.
